The Epic Tale Of Jamie And Claire Fraser: A Timeless Love Story
Who are Jamie and Claire Fraser? The answer to this question can take us on a captivating journey through the enchanting world of historical fiction, sweeping us into the heart of a timeless love story that has captivated millions worldwide.
Jamie Fraser, a dashing Scottish Highlander, and Claire Randall, a strong-willed English nurse, are the central characters in Diana Gabaldon's "Outlander" series. Their extraordinary tale begins in 1945 when Claire mysteriously travels back in time to 18th-century Scotland during World War II.
Their love story unfolds against a backdrop of political turmoil, cultural clashes, and the unforgiving beauty of the Scottish Highlands. Jamie, a Jacobite rebel, fights for his homeland's independence, while Claire, with her medical knowledge from the future, finds herself torn between her duty to her own time and her love for Jamie.

Historical Context
The historical context of 18th-century Scotland plays a pivotal role in shaping the journey of Jamie and Claire Fraser. Set against a backdrop of political upheaval and cultural clashes, their story delves into the complexities of a society in transition.
Read also:Larry Mullen Jr The Heartbeat Of U2
Political Turmoil: Jamie Fraser is a Jacobite rebel, fighting for the independence of Scotland from British rule. His involvement in the Jacobite cause brings him into direct conflict with the British army, leading to battles, imprisonment, and the threat of execution. Claire, caught in the crossfire of political allegiances, must navigate a dangerous landscape while trying to protect herself and those she loves.
Cultural Clashes: The encounter between Jamie, a proud Highlander, and Claire, an Englishwoman from the 20th century, highlights the stark cultural differences of the time. Their relationship challenges societal norms and prejudices, as they learn to bridge the gap between their respective worlds. Claire's knowledge of modern medicine and her independent spirit clash with the traditional gender roles and beliefs of 18th-century Scotland.
